EDUCATION

With a core commitment to creating meaningful educational experiences, MDC Live Arts, strives not only to present excellence in the performing arts, but also to develop future artists and audiences through educational outreach. All of the artists who perform each season share their experience and talent through extended residencies, master classes, discussions and demonstrations for our students and the community. Some residencies aim to build new audiences while others provide professional development opportunities to local artists. Others address the social issues explored in the artist's work while still more focus on technique or history.

Participants will explore new ways to access their bodies’ original language and vocabulary, which will allow for the creation of singular, relevant choreographies. In this Lab, Chipaumire asks participants to ponder how history, place, gender, race, class, language, and globalization have marked their bodies.

About Nora Chipaumire

Born in Mutare, Zimbabwe, and currently living in New York City, dance/choreographer Nora Chipaumire has been challenging stereotypes of Africa and the black performing body, art and aesthetic for the past decade. Chipaumire holds an M.A. in dance and an M.F.A. in choreography and performance from Mills College in California. She is a two-time Bessie Award winner and former associate artistic director with the Urban Bush Women, as well as an Alpert Award recipient and U.S. Ford Fellow.

Urban Bush Women


Are We Democracy

October 22-27
Presented in partnership with South Miami-Dade Cultural Arts Center

As we head into the 2012 election cycle, acclaimed dancers Urban Bush Women offer an innovative week-long residency utilizing the arts to explore issues of civic engagement, centered around the question – Are We Democracy? The residency culminates with a community performance on October 27th at the South Dade Cultural Arts Center, where student and community residency participants share their artistic vision on the issue, examining their dreams and challenges around democracy and civic participation.
